Simarine STR1 - Radar Tank Level Sender

Non-Contact Liquid Level Measurement

The new Simarine STR1 is a non-contact radar liquid level sensor designed for tanks with a height of 150–2000 mm. The device uses microwave technology, allowing measurements to be taken completely without any intrusion into the tank and with no moving parts.

Compatibility with Existing Systems

STR1 has been designed as an analog version, offering maximum compatibility with existing measurement systems. The sensor simultaneously provides three standard signal output types:

  • 0–190 Ω
  • 240–30 Ω
  • 0–5 V

This allows it to work with a wide range of gauges and monitoring systems without the need for additional converters.

Simple Top-of-Tank Installation

Installation is carried out from the top of the tank, with no holes required in its walls. The STR1 can measure levels through plastic and GRP lids, which significantly simplifies installation and eliminates the risk of leaks. For metal tanks, a dedicated waveguide adapter is required, as shown in the image below.

Durability and Stable Readings

The device has no mechanical parts, making it resistant to wear, corrosion, and fouling that are typical of conventional float sensors. In addition, signal filtering ensures stable readings even when the liquid is sloshing.

In practice, this means:
  • No moving parts subject to wear
  • Lower risk of failure compared to conventional float sensors
  • More stable measurement when the liquid is in motion
  • Greater resistance to fouling and corrosion

Configuration via the Simarine App

Configuration and calibration is carried out wirelessly through the Simarine app. The user can define the tank curve with up to 100 measurement points, enabling accurate representation of tanks with irregular shapes.
